The steamboat Natchez has been in operation since 1975, and is the ninth vessel to bear this name.

From the copper bell made from 250 melted silver dollars to the white oak and steel paddle wheel, you’ll be mesmerized as soon as you step on board.

The cruise departs from the Toulouse Street Wharf behind Jax Brewery, boarding begins at 6pm and the cruise is from 7pm-9pm.
